A promoter trap strategy was used to replace exons 3 and 4 with an SA-IRES-betageo-pA cassette. The resulting protein encoded from the locus would contain only the five N-terminal amino acids fused to lacZ-neo, thereby inactivating both the full-length and the proposed short form of amyotrophic lateral sclerosis 2 (juvenile) homolog. Absence of protein was confirmed by Western blot analysis of cortex, cerebellum and testis.
